kobalicek b56f4176cb Codebase update and improvements, instruction DB update
* Denested src folder to root, renamed testing to asmjit-testing

  * Refactored how headers are included into <asmjit/...> form. This
    is necessary as compilers would never simplify a path once a ..
    appears in include directory - then paths such as ../core/../core
    appeared in asserts, which was ugly

  * Moved support utilities into asmjit/support/... (still included
    by asmjit/core.h for convenience and compatibility)

  * Added CMakePresets.json for making it easy to develop AsmJit

  * Reworked CMakeLists to be shorter and use CMake option(),
    etc... This simplifies it and makes it using more standard
    features

  * ASMJIT_EMBED now creates asmjit_embed INTERFACE library,
    which is accessible via asmjit::asmjit target - this simplifies
    embedding and makes it the same as library targets from a CMake
    perspective

  * Removed ASMJIT_DEPS - this is now provided by cmake target
    aliases - 'asmjit::asmjit' so users should not need this variable

  * Changed meaning of ASMJIT_LIBS - this now contains only AsmJit
    dependencies without asmjit::asmjit target alias. Don't rely on
    ASMJIT_LIBS anymore as it's only used internally

  * Removed ASMJIT_NO_DEPRECATED option - AsmJit is not going
    to provide controllable deprecations in the future

  * Removed ASMJIT_NO_VALIDATION in favor of ASMJIT_NO_INTROSPECTION,
    which now controls query, features, and validation API presence

  * Removed ASMJIT_DIR option - it was never really needed

  * Removed AMX_TRANSPOSE feature from instruction database (X86).
    Intel has removed it as well, so it's a feature that won't
    be siliconized

// BaseRAPass - CFG - Dominators
// =============================
static ASMJIT_INLINE RABlock* intersect_blocks(RABlock* b1, RABlock* b2) noexcept {
while (b1 != b2) {
while (b2->pov_index() > b1->pov_index()) b1 = b1->idom();
while (b1->pov_index() > b2->pov_index()) b2 = b2->idom();
}
return b1;
}
// Based on "A Simple, Fast Dominance Algorithm".
Error BaseRAPass::build_cfg_dominators() noexcept {
#ifndef 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
Logger* logger = logger_if(DiagnosticOptions::kRADebugCFG);
ASMJIT_RA_LOG_FORMAT("[build_cfg_dominators]\n");
#endif // !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
if (_blocks.is_empty()) {
return Error::kOk;
}
RABlock* entry_block = this->entry_block();
entry_block->_idom = entry_block;
bool changed = true;
#ifndef 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
uint32_t iter_count = 0;
#endif // !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
while (changed) {
changed = false;
#ifndef 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
iter_count++;
#endif // !ASMJIT_NO_LOGGING
for (RABlock* block : _pov.iterate_reverse()) {
if (block == entry_block) {
continue;
}
RABlock* idom = nullptr;
Span<RABlock*> predecessors = block->predecessors();
for (RABlock* p : predecessors.iterate_reverse()) {
if (!p->idom()) {
continue;
}
idom = !idom ? p : intersect_blocks(idom, p);
}
if (block->idom() != idom) {
ASMJIT_ASSUME(idom != nullptr);
ASMJIT_RA_LOG_FORMAT(" idom of #%u -> #%u\n", block->block_id(), idom->block_id());
block->_idom = idom;
changed = true;
}
}
}
ASMJIT_RA_LOG_FORMAT(" done (%u iterations)\n", iter_count);
return Error::kOk;
}

// BaseRAPass - Registers - Liveness Analysis and Statistics
// =========================================================
template<typename BitMutator>
static ASMJIT_INLINE void BaseRAPass_calculate_initial_in_out(RABlock* block, size_t live_word_count, Support::FixedStack<RABlock*>& queue, uint32_t pov_index) noexcept {
using BitWord = Support::BitWord;
// Calculate LIVE-OUT based on LIVE-IN of all successors and then recalculate LIVE-IN based on LIVE-OUT and KILL bits.
Span<RABlock*> successors = block->successors();
if (!successors.is_empty()) {
BitMutator bm_live_in(block->live_in());
BitMutator bm_live_out(block->live_out());
BitMutator bm_kill(block->kill());
for (RABlock* successor : successors.iterate_reverse()) {
if (Support::bool_and(successor->pov_index() > pov_index, !successor->is_enqueued())) {
successor->add_flags(RABlockFlags::kIsEnqueued);
queue.push(successor);
continue;
}
BitMutator bm_successor_live_in(successor->live_in());
for (uint32_t bw = 0; bw < live_word_count; bw++) {
BitWord sc = bm_successor_live_in.bit_word(bw);
BitWord in = bm_live_in.bit_word(bw) | sc;
BitWord out = bm_live_out.bit_word(bw) | sc;
bm_live_in.set_bit_word(bw, in & ~bm_kill.bit_word(bw));
bm_live_out.set_bit_word(bw, out);
}
bm_live_in.commit(block->live_in());
bm_live_out.commit(block->live_out());
}
}
}
// Calculate LIVE-IN and LIVE-OUT of the given `block` and a single `successor` that has changed its LIVE-IN bits.
template<typename BitMutator>
static ASMJIT_INLINE Support::BitWord BaseRAPass_recalculateInOut(RABlock* block, size_t live_word_count, RABlock* successor) noexcept {
using BitWord = Support::BitWord;
BitMutator bm_live_in(block->live_in());
BitMutator bm_live_out(block->live_out());
BitMutator bm_kill(block->kill());
BitMutator bm_successor_live_in(successor->live_in());
BitWord changed = 0u;
for (size_t i = 0; i < live_word_count; i++) {
BitWord succ_in = bm_successor_live_in.bit_word(i);
BitWord in = bm_live_in.bit_word(i);
BitWord out = bm_live_out.bit_word(i);
BitWord kill = bm_kill.bit_word(i);
BitWord new_in = (in | succ_in) & ~kill;
BitWord new_out = (out | succ_in);
bm_live_in.set_bit_word(i, new_in);
bm_live_out.set_bit_word(i, new_out);
changed |= in ^ new_in;
}
bm_live_in.commit(block->live_in());
bm_live_out.commit(block->live_out());
return changed;
}
template<typename BitMutator>
static ASMJIT_INLINE Error BaseRAPass_calculateInOutKill(
BaseRAPass* pass,
uint32_t* n_uses_per_work_reg,
uint32_t* n_outs_per_work_reg,
uint32_t* n_insts_per_block,
Out<uint32_t> num_visits_out
) noexcept {
Span<RABlock*> pov = pass->_pov.as_span();
size_t multi_work_reg_count = pass->multi_work_reg_count();
size_t multi_work_reg_count_as_bit_words = BitOps::size_in_words<BitWord>(multi_work_reg_count);
constexpr RAWorkRegFlags kLiveFlag = RAWorkRegFlags::kSingleBlockLiveFlag;
constexpr RAWorkRegFlags kVisitedFlag = RAWorkRegFlags::kSingleBlockVisitedFlag;
// Calculate GEN and KILL and then initial LIVE-IN and LIVE-OUT bits.
//
// GEN is mapped to LIVE-IN, because it's not needed after LIVE-IN is calculated,
// which is essentially `LIVE-IN = GEN & ~KILL` - so once we know GEN and KILL for
// each block, calculating LIVE-IN is trivial.
for (RABlock* block : pov.iterate()) {
ASMJIT_PROPAGATE(block->alloc_live_bits(multi_work_reg_count));
BaseNode* node = block->last();
BaseNode* stop = block->first();
BitMutator live_in(block->live_in()); // LIVE-IN which maps to GEN as well.
BitMutator kill(block->kill()); // KILL only.
RABlockId block_id = block->block_id();
uint32_t inst_count = 0;
for (;;) {
if (node->is_inst()) {
InstNode* inst = node->as<InstNode>();
RAInst* ra_inst = inst->pass_data<RAInst>();
ASMJIT_ASSERT(ra_inst != nullptr);
RATiedReg* tied_regs = ra_inst->tied_regs();
uint32_t count = ra_inst->tied_count();
for (uint32_t j = 0; j < count; j++) {
RATiedReg* tied_reg = &tied_regs[j];
RAWorkReg* work_reg = tied_reg->work_reg();
RAWorkId work_id = work_reg->work_id();
// Update `n_uses` and `n_outs`.
n_uses_per_work_reg[uint32_t(work_id)] += 1u;
n_outs_per_work_reg[uint32_t(work_id)] += uint32_t(tied_reg->is_write());
bool is_kill = tied_reg->is_write_only();
RATiedFlags tied_flags = tied_reg->flags();
// Mark as:
// KILL - if this VirtReg is killed afterwards.
// LAST - if this VirtReg is last in this basic block.
if (work_reg->is_within_single_basic_block()) {
bool was_kill = !Support::test(work_reg->flags(), kLiveFlag);
bool was_last = !Support::test(work_reg->flags(), kVisitedFlag);
tied_flags |= Support::bool_as_flag<RATiedFlags::kKill>(was_kill);
tied_flags |= Support::bool_as_flag<RATiedFlags::kLast>(was_last);
work_reg->add_flags(kVisitedFlag);
work_reg->xor_flags(Support::bool_as_flag<kLiveFlag>(uint32_t(is_kill ^ was_kill)));
}
else {
bool was_kill = kill.bit_at(work_id);
bool was_last = !live_in.bit_at(work_id);
tied_flags |= Support::bool_as_flag<RATiedFlags::kKill>(was_kill);
tied_flags |= Support::bool_as_flag<RATiedFlags::kLast>(was_last);
// KILL if the register is write only, otherwise GEN.
live_in.add_bit(work_id, !is_kill);
kill.xor_bit(work_id, bool(is_kill ^ was_kill));
}
tied_reg->_flags = tied_flags;
if (tied_reg->is_lead_consecutive()) {
work_reg->mark_lead_consecutive();
}
if (tied_reg->has_consecutive_parent()) {
RAWorkReg* consecutive_parent_reg = tied_reg->consecutive_parent();
ASMJIT_PROPAGATE(consecutive_parent_reg->add_immediate_consecutive(pass->arena(), work_id));
}
}
inst_count++;
}
if (node == stop) {
break;
}
node = node->prev();
ASMJIT_ASSERT(node != nullptr);
}
n_insts_per_block[uint32_t(block_id)] = inst_count;
// Calculate initial LIVE-IN from GEN - LIVE-IN = GEN & ~KILL.
live_in.clear_bits(kill);
live_in.commit(block->live_in());
kill.commit(block->kill());
}
// Calculate initial values of LIVE-OUT and update LIVE-IN accordingly to LIVE-OUT.
//
// This step requires a queue, however, we only add a node's successors to the queue, which post-order-index
// is greater than the post-order-index of the block being processed. This makes the next pass much faster to
// converge.
uint32_t num_visits = 0u;
if (multi_work_reg_count_as_bit_words > 0u) {
ArenaVector<RABlock*> queue_storage;
ASMJIT_PROPAGATE(queue_storage.reserve_fit(pass->arena(), pov.size()));
Support::FixedStack<RABlock*> queue(queue_storage.data(), pov.size());
for (size_t pov_index = 0u; pov_index < pov.size(); pov_index++) {
RABlock* block = pov[pov_index];
BaseRAPass_calculate_initial_in_out<BitMutator>(block, multi_work_reg_count_as_bit_words, queue, uint32_t(pov_index));
}
// Iteratively keep recalculating LIVE-IN and LIVE-OUT once there are no more changes to the bits. This is
// needed as there may be cycles in the CFG, which have to be propagated. This algorithm essentially uses a
// work queue where nodes that change are pushed to propagate the changes to all predecessor nodes.
while (!queue.is_empty()) {
num_visits++;
RABlock* block = queue.pop();
block->clear_flags(RABlockFlags::kIsEnqueued);
for (RABlock* predecessor : block->predecessors()) {
Support::BitWord changed = BaseRAPass_recalculateInOut<BitMutator>(predecessor, multi_work_reg_count_as_bit_words, block);
if (Support::bool_and(changed, !predecessor->is_enqueued())) {
predecessor->add_flags(RABlockFlags::kIsEnqueued);
queue.push(predecessor);
}
}
}
queue_storage.release(pass->arena());
}
num_visits_out = num_visits;
return Error::kOk;
}
